Certification Complexity for Southeast Asia: Southeast Asian markets require specific certifications: SIRIM (Malaysia), SNI (Indonesia), TISI (Thailand), QCVN (Vietnam), PS mark (Philippines). Smart Smoke Detector Market Growth in Southeast Asia: The Southeast Asian smart smoke and gas detector market is projected to grow at 15% CAGR through 2030, driven by: rapid urbanization (60% of ASEAN population in cities by 2030); smart city initiatives (Singapore Smart Nation, Malaysia Smart City, Indonesia Smart City); mandatory fire code enforcement; and the shift from standalone to connected detectors. 4G and NB-IoT connectivity dominate due to excellent mobile coverage and low-power requirements.
Connectivity Technology Convergence: The smart detector market is converging on multiple connectivity technologies: 4G LTE Cat.1 (direct cellular, no gateway needed), NB-IoT (ultra-low power, deep penetration, large-scale), LoRaWAN (long-range, industrial/campus), WiFi (smart home), and RF mesh (interconnected residential).
